Invest in Stock That You Understand

Investing in stock is about understanding the market and how it works. If you want to avoid getting sucked into the stock-market bubble, stay away from stock that is popular but you don't understand.

Start out by investing in stock for companies that you have an interest in already. This can help you begin to understand what the company is worth and their business position. For example, if you love video games, perhaps you start by investing the company's behind the biggest gaming consoles and perhaps televisions. If you really like sports, start by investing in companies that own sports teams. If you are really into clothing, invest in some clothing designers or retailers.

Investing in stock for companies that you are already interested in can help you learn how the market works since you understand the basic principles of the company already. It may not be a perfect long-term strategy, but is a great way to get your bearings.

Look at the Debt That a Company Holds

When choosing companies to invest in, take some time to look at the level of debt that the company has. The less debt a company has, the better. If a company has too much debt, that could hold the company back from surviving an economic downturn or slowing in the market. Investing in companies that are carrying less debt can help protect your investments.

Be Patient with Your Stock

Second, learn to be patient with your stock. Not all the stock you purchase is going to increase quickly in value. The value that stock holds is in its long-term potential. Instead of trading your stock because it hasn't skyrocketed in value, take your time with your stock. Realize that some stocks increase slowly over time, and be patient with your stock. Don't drop something that is holding it value or is gradually increasing in value. It's good to have stock that retains its value in your portfolio.
